You'll thank your lucky charms, er, stars when you hit the ultrapopular watering hole Dicey Riley's in Fort Lauderdale's Himmarshee Village. An actual Irishman owns this authentic pub, and steel-bellied locals as well as out-of-towners haunt the spot in true Erin go bragh fashion. The full liquor bar and dining area has an out-of-Fort Lauderdale feeling, and framed photos of old-time Hollywood starlets and comedians on the walls add to that pub feel. On a recent Saturday night, the entire place was singing along to Joan Jett's "I Love Rock 'n' Roll." OK, it's not exactly Irish but a rowdy crowd pleaser nonetheless. As everyone sang about putting another dime in the jukebox, people were stacked this close at the bar for their next round of Guinness.

The mixed bunch of 20- and 30-somethings may feel like a junior high reunion, but it comes off more as just ordinary times at Dicey's. In addition to canned tunes, the pub offers live music most nights, from traditional Irish bands to funk, rock and the occasional jam band. It also has a full kitchen, which serves up yummy dinner specials, such as the very un-Irish lasagna, and standard pub treats like fish and chips. -- Terra Sullivan, City Link (July 6, 2005)
